FAILE x NYCB.

New York City Ballet is introducing the Art Series where they will commission contemporary artists to create original works of art inspired by the Company, its history, and repertory. The inaugural collaboration features Brooklyn-based artists FAILE, and each attendee to the 2/1 and 5/29 Art Series performances will receive a limited-edition work made specifically for this event.

LIFEPROOF.

I’ve been looking to get a underwater case since last summer for the iPhone 4, now with the iPhone 5 out I started looking again. LifeProof was one of the front runners with what seems to be the slimmest case, but has not been available for the iPhone 5 until now.

I have to admit when I took a look at the case that would be protecting my “precious” I was taken back a bit. It looked a bit flimsy but was understandable since it is such a slim case. So without too much hesitation I followed the instructions… testing the case first without the phone submerged in water for an hour. OK. Then securing the phone and giving it a go.

It worked. My phone survived it’s first underwater experience. But be advised I did get my phone wet getting it out of the case, no harm done though. So if your in the market for an underwater case check out the LifeProof case. Please don’t blame me if the case fails, also don’t skip the water test even if it is a brand new case.

AS REAL AS IT GETS

Come check out the “As Real As It Gets” show organized by Rob Walker, we’ve got a piece in there among some other great artists and designers. So come out and show some support November 15th!


Shawn Wolfe, Gross National Products Presents, 2012 (detail)

“As Real As It Gets” is an exploration of “imaginary brands and fictional products,” it includes works (including new commissions) by Shawn Wolfe, Conrad Bakker, Dana Wyse, Kelli Anderson, Staple Design, Ryan Watkins-Hughes, Steven M. Johnson, and the U.S. Government Accountability Office, among others. Attractions include a speculative retail soundscape via Marc Weidenbaum/Disquiet Junto, and the ongoing production of Shawn Wolfe’s RemoverInstaller™ object on a MakerBot Replicator 3D printer.

Organizer Rob Walker will be at the opening, November 15 from 6-8pm, along with a number of the contributing artists. Various promotional items for nonexistent brands will be available for the taking. Come early to sample a bottle of Tru Blood, courtesy of Omni Consumer Products.
